Pokk?n DX Tournament for Switch, Pok?mon Ultra Sun/Moon for 3DS revealed

Depending on what you expectations were going into this Pok?mon focused Nintendo Direct, you may be super excited or somewhat let down if you’re a Pok?mon fan or Switch owner. The big announcement was… Pokk?n DX Tournament, an enhanced fighting game followup of sorts to the Wii U’s Pokk?n Tournament.

Also announced during the presentation was Pok?mon Ultra Sun and Pok?mon Ultra Moon for the Nintendo 3DS, which are expanded versions of Sun and Moon, which will launch on November 17th, 2017.

Pokk?n DX Tournament for the Nintendo Switch is scheduled for a September 22nd, 2017 release and it’ll be present at the E3 this year, and even have an Invitational tournament of its own.

Pok?mon Direct announcement details:

During today?s Pok?mon Direct presentation, Tsunekazu Ishihara, president and CEO of The Pok?mon Company, and Junichi Masuda, Director of GAME FREAK, announced upcoming Pok?mon titles for Nintendo consoles.

Pok?mon is making its way to Nintendo Switch later this year with Pokk?n Tournament DX. Along with all the content from both the Wii U and arcade versions of Pokk?n Tournament, the Pok?mon fighting game where Pok?mon in battle move in direct response to the player?s actions, Pokk?n Tournament DX also introduces an array of exciting new features to create the ultimate Pokk?n experience. Pokk?n Tournament DX features include:

  • Play Pokk?n anytime, anywhere on Nintendo Switch ? Play Pokk?n Tournament DX in TV mode, handheld mode, or share a Joy-Con controller with another Trainer to battle one-on-one in tabletop mode anywhere!
  • A brand-new fighter ? Decidueye enters the battle, alongside all previous Pok?mon from the Wii U and arcade versions.
  • New Support Pok?mon ? Litten and Popplio make their debut to lend their support in battle.
  • Team Battle mode ? Pick three Pok?mon and battle it out to be the first to defeat all your opponent?s Pok?mon to win in the new Team Battle mode.
  • Group Match mode ? Find similar skilled players in battle rooms for intense and fun battles online.
  • Daily Challenges ? Complete a variety of different daily challenges.
  • Watch battle replays ? Hone your skills by watching other players? replays and share your best matches online with the new replay feature.
  • Jump straight into battle – All characters and Support Pok?mon will be available right from the start of the game.

Pokk?n Tournament DX will launch on Nintendo Switch September 22, 2017.

During Pok?mon Direct, viewers also saw the first footage from the newest titles in the Pok?mon series, Pok?mon Ultra Sun and Pok?mon Ultra Moon. Two new Pok?mon forms were shown resembling that of the Legendary Pok?mon Solgaleo and Lunala. Pok?mon Ultra Sun and Pok?mon Ultra Moon have been powered up with new additions to the story and features from Pok?mon Sun and Pok?mon Moon. Pok?mon Ultra Sun and Pok?mon Ultra Moon are scheduled to release worldwide on November 17, 2017?more information about the games will be revealed later this year.

Also announced, the second titles in the Pok?mon series, Pok?mon Gold and Pok?mon Silver, will be making their way to the Nintendo 3DS Virtual Console. Pok?mon Gold and Pok?mon Silver were released in Japan on November 21, 1999, as the second set of titles in the Pok?mon series. These games, which debuted as Game Boy Color-titles in Japan, are being recreated into Virtual Console versions such that their screens appear just as they did on the Game Boy Color. Both titles will be compatible with the wireless communication features of the Nintendo 3DS and Trainers can look forward to Link Trades and Link Battles between Virtual Console versions of Pok?mon Gold and Pok?mon Silver. In addition, these titles will be compatible with the Time Capsule function, which allows players to Link Trade Pok?mon between the Virtual Console versions of Pok?mon Gold or Pok?mon Silver and the Virtual Console versions of Pok?mon Red, Pok?mon Blue, or Pok?mon Yellow in Pok?mon Centers within the games. Both titles will be compatible with Pok?mon Bank and will also launch on September 22, 2017.
